Oommen Chandy's escapes unhurt as his car meets with an accident

Written by : TNM Staff

Kerala Chief Minister Oommen Chandy escaped unhurt when his car met with an accident in Ettumanoor near Kottayam at 2.30 am on Sunday. His gunman Ashokan received minor injuries.

CM’s car skidded off the road and jumped on the footpath’s concrete slab. CM was sleeping inside and was not injured. He was travelling from Malappuram to Kottayam and continued his journey in escort vehicle.

CM told media that he was not sure of what actually happened as he was on a sleep.

He was examined by a team of doctors from the general hospital at the Nattakam Guest House.
